当前位置:首页 / EXCEL

Excel编号如何精准匹配姓名?姓名匹配技巧分享!

作者:佚名|分类:EXCEL|浏览:83|发布时间:2025-04-05 00:32:32

Excel编号如何精准匹配姓名?姓名匹配技巧分享!

一、引言

在日常生活中,我们经常需要使用Excel表格进行数据管理。而在处理数据时,常常会遇到需要根据编号精准匹配姓名的情况。那么,如何才能在Excel中实现编号与姓名的精准匹配呢?本文将为大家分享一些姓名匹配的技巧,帮助大家轻松解决这一问题。

二、Excel编号精准匹配姓名的方法

1. 使用VLOOKUP函数

VLOOKUP函数是Excel中常用的查找函数,可以按照指定的列查找数据。下面以一个示例来说明如何使用VLOOKUP函数实现编号与姓名的精准匹配。

假设我们有一个包含编号和姓名的表格,如下所示:

| 编号 | 姓名 |

| ---| ---|

| 001 | 张三 |

| 002 | 李四 |

| 003 | 王五 |

现在我们需要根据编号查找对应的姓名。在另一个单元格中输入以下公式:

=VLOOKUP(A2,$A$2:$B$3,2,FALSE)

其中,A2为要查找的编号,$A$2:$B$3为包含编号和姓名的表格区域,2表示返回姓名所在的列,FALSE表示精确匹配。

2. 使用INDEX和MATCH函数

INDEX和MATCH函数可以组合使用,实现类似VLOOKUP函数的功能。下面以一个示例来说明如何使用这两个函数实现编号与姓名的精准匹配。

继续使用上面的示例表格,现在我们需要根据编号查找对应的姓名。在另一个单元格中输入以下公式:

=INDEX($B$2:$B$3,MATCH(A2,$A$2:$A$3,0))

其中,$B$2:$B$3为包含姓名的表格区域,MATCH(A2,$A$2:$A$3,0)表示查找编号所在的行,0表示精确匹配。

3. 使用数组公式

如果需要一次性匹配多个编号与姓名,可以使用数组公式。下面以一个示例来说明如何使用数组公式实现编号与姓名的精准匹配。

假设我们有一个包含多个编号的列表,如下所示:

| 编号 |

| ---|

| 001 |

| 002 |

| 003 |

现在我们需要根据编号查找对应的姓名。在另一个单元格中输入以下数组公式:

=IFERROR(INDEX($B$2:$B$3,MATCH($A$2:$A$4,$A$2:$A$4,0)), "")

其中,$B$2:$B$3为包含姓名的表格区域,$A$2:$A$4为包含编号的列表,IFERROR函数用于处理匹配失败的情况。

三、姓名匹配技巧分享

1. 规范化姓名格式

在处理姓名数据时,尽量保持姓名格式的统一,如使用全角字符、去掉空格等,以便于后续的匹配操作。

2. 使用模糊匹配

如果无法确保编号与姓名的完全一致,可以使用模糊匹配。在VLOOKUP、INDEX和MATCH函数中,将精确匹配参数设置为TRUE或1,即可实现模糊匹配。

3. 使用辅助列

在处理大量数据时,为了提高匹配效率,可以创建一个辅助列,将编号与姓名进行关联。这样,在查找数据时,只需关注辅助列即可。

四、相关问答

1. 问题:VLOOKUP函数和INDEX和MATCH函数有什么区别?

回答:VLOOKUP函数和INDEX和MATCH函数都可以实现查找功能,但VLOOKUP函数在查找过程中只能返回匹配的第一个结果,而INDEX和MATCH函数可以返回多个匹配结果。

2. 问题:如何处理姓名中包含空格的情况?

回答:在处理姓名数据时,可以使用TRIM函数去除空格,或者使用文本函数将空格替换为其他字符。

3. 问题:如何处理姓名中包含特殊字符的情况?

回答:可以使用文本函数将特殊字符替换为空格或删除,以便于后续的匹配操作。

总结

通过本文的介绍,相信大家对Excel编号如何精准匹配姓名以及姓名匹配技巧有了更深入的了解。在实际操作中,可以根据具体需求选择合适的方法,提高数据处理的效率。


参考内容:http://liuxue.cyts888.com/gonglue/912.html